The UAE hospitality sector is renowned for its luxury hotels, resorts, and entertainment complexes. As tourism and business travel continue to thrive, financial management has become a critical focus for hospitality groups to ensure profitability and operational efficiency. One of the key roles in this domain is finance controller jobs in UAE hospitality groups, responsible for managing accounting functions, financial reporting, and budgeting processes across multiple properties or outlets. Finance controllers play a pivotal role in strategic decision-making by analyzing financial data, managing cash flows, and ensuring compliance with international accounting standards. For experienced finance professionals, this career path offers stability, high earning potential, and exposure to international business practices.

Requirements for Finance Controller Roles

To qualify for a finance controller role in a UAE hospitality group, candidates typically need:

  • Education: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or Business Administration.
  • Experience: 5–10 years in financial management, with experience in hospitality or multi-property operations preferred.
  • Certifications: CPA, ACCA, or CMA are highly valued.
  • Technical Skills: Expertise in accounting software such as SAP, Oracle, or Micros-Fidelio.
  • Financial Expertise: Budgeting, forecasting, cash flow management, and reporting.
  • Compliance Knowledge: Familiarity with UAE VAT laws, IFRS standards, and financial regulations.
  • Leadership Skills: Ability to manage finance teams, collaborate with department heads, and provide strategic insights.
Salary & Benefits

Finance controllers in UAE hospitality groups enjoy competitive, tax-free salaries and comprehensive benefits. Typical packages include:

  • Salary Range: AED 20,000 – AED 40,000 per month.
  • Housing Allowance: Some employers provide housing or include it in the salary.
  • Transportation: Company car or travel allowance.
  • Medical Insurance: Coverage for employees and dependents.
  • Annual Bonus: Performance-based incentives.
  • Flight Tickets: Annual air travel allowance for the home country.
  • Professional Development: Opportunities to attend workshops, training, and certification programs.

FAQ – Finance Controller UAE Hospitality Jobs

Q1: What is the average salary for finance controllers in UAE hospitality groups?
A: Salaries typically range from AED 20,000 – AED 40,000 per month, depending on experience.

Q2: Do hospitality groups provide visa sponsorship?
A: Yes, most UAE hospitality employers offer full visa sponsorship and relocation assistance.

Q3: Which certifications are preferred for finance controller roles?
A: CPA, ACCA, and CMA are highly valued in the UAE hospitality sector.

Q4: Can international candidates apply for finance controller positions in UAE?
A: Absolutely, hospitality groups welcome skilled finance professionals from around the world.

Q5: What skills are most important for finance controllers?
A: Budgeting, financial reporting, cash flow management, team leadership, and compliance knowledge.
